Handover note — Crumbwheel order cutoffs.

Welcome aboard. The bakery cutoff rule in Crumbwheel closes same-day orders at 14:00 local to each storefront, not UTC — this has bitten us twice. Holiday overrides live in the calendar service and take precedence silently, so always check there first when a cutoff looks wrong. To unlock the calendar service's admin console after a restart, enter the recovery passphrase below.

vault phrase of bagap-bahaf = silion-pelox-sorox-casdor-quenwyn-fraax-eliox-praael-kelion-quenvan-kasox-rusael-norius-belvan

Break-glass access: flaky DNS on Pluggle Hub. Plugin authors — if lookups to the Hubwright registry intermittently fail, it's usually the resolver pool on the Calder node shedding entries. Don't retry-loop; file it and use the break-glass resolver instead. Access to that emergency resolver requires unsealing the fallback config, and the recovery passphrase sits just below.

vault phrase of tajop-haduf = holath-brivan-wenax

## Changelog — Prunewright Bot v1.6

The stale-branch cleanup bot now applies to plugin repositories. Branches with no commits in 90 days and no open pull request are flagged, then deleted after a 14-day grace period. Plugin authors can opt specific branches out via a keep-list file in the repo root; wildcards are supported. Deleted branches remain recoverable for 30 days through the restore command. Notification cadence is weekly rather than per-branch. Exemption requests and policy questions should be routed to the bot's maintainer.

signatory, tadup-fahog: Zorwyn Keleth